Description

With the ESR 1200, Crown has achieved its goal of increasing both the customer benefit and the sustainability of the reach truck. To this end, the entire value chain of the ESR was examined and improved in order to achieve environmentally friendly production. This involved not only improving the vehicle itself, but also selecting local suppliers and implementing new production technologies, for example. As a result, transportation routes were shortened, the recycling rate increased and material and energy consumption reduced, leading to an overall reduction in CO2 emissions.

At the same time, Crown has revolutionized the mast concept. The new ESR 1200 offers more stability, fewer vibrations and better visibility for the operator. The up to 21 percent stronger residual capacities and higher lifting heights (up to 14205 mm) also enable a new type of storage layout at the customer’s site for even more efficient use of space. Crown used a clever solution to make the masts more stable and to increase the visibility of the operator at the same time. Instead of adding more material, Crown has used the existing material more effectively. The result is a new, compact pole design based on a unique double T-plus profile. The masts are therefore more stable and at the same time the operator has a better view.

In addition to other product features, such as height-dependent activated line lights, the entire reach truck portfolio has been adapted to offer the right truck for every application. The ESR 1240 is now also available for applications with lifting heights of over 9.5 meters and capacities of 2 tonnes. This downsizing approach allows the trucks to be used with less energy; a previous 2-ton truck can now be replaced by a 1.5-ton truck. The ESR 1200 series is equipped with the Gena operating system and – like the SP 1500 order picking truck or the TSP 1000 narrow-aisle stacker – can be networked with the Crown InfoLink fleet management system.

Test report

Crown is expanding its successful ESR 1000 reach truck series with the ESR 1200 series. This extension represents a holistic concept designed to increase both robustness and productivity.

An outstanding feature of the ESR 1200 is its innovative mast design. The new, compact mast offers improved stability and optimized visibility for the operator. In addition, mast vibrations have been further reduced. Compared to the previous model, the new mast has up to 36 percent less elastic deflection. In combination with a more powerful lift pump motor (for the ESR 1240), the new mast design enables a maximum lift height of up to 14,205 mm. By reducing mast vibrations, the driver retains precise control of the truck even at great heights, which increases productivity and safety.

The basis for the innovative mast design is a new type of mast profile that is manufactured exclusively for Crown in Germany. In contrast to the old profile, which consisted of welded parts, the new profiles are manufactured in one piece, resulting in a mast that is up to 36 percent stiffer and offers a residual load-bearing capacity of up to 21 percent without seams.

Another innovation is the patented mast damping system, which reduces the impact of the load on the ground during mast changes. Although the system still has room for improvement at ground level, it made a positive impression in the test and contributes to the safety of the truck. The optional Xpress Lower mechanism doubles the lowering speed and shows above-average performance compared to the market average in this segment.

Thanks to the use of lithium-ion batteries and optional regenerative lowering, the new reach truck consumes around 30 percent less energy compared to the market average. Crown is also focusing on sustainability in manufacturing by selecting local suppliers and implementing new production technologies, resulting in shorter transportation distances, a higher recycling rate and a reduced environmental footprint.

The launch of the ESR 1200 includes an update of the entire reach truck range of Crown to offer the right truck for every application. For example, the ESR 1240 is now also available for lift heights of more than 9.5 meters and load capacities of two tons, resulting in more efficient energy utilization.

The ESR 1200 series is equipped with the proven Gena control system and can be networked with the Crown InfoLink fleet management system.

IFOY Verdict

The new mast design offers increased residual load capacity, stability and contributes to a lower carbon footprint. During the standard performance test, the mast could not be extended to the maximum to check the effect of reduced mast sway at a height of 14 meters. Nevertheless, the static IFOY test up to a height of ten meters confirmed the outstanding stability of the truck and the almost complete absence of mast oscillation during the extension movements, giving an extremely safe driving experience. The testers found the steering to be too light at high speeds, which can affect the predictability of the truck. Overall, the truck offers above-average performance and the improved carbon footprint is an added bon.

IFOY Innovation Check

Functionality / Type of implementation

The high standard of function-oriented design of the overall vehicle and especially the driver’s platform, already familiar from Crown, also applies to the ESR 1200, which offers the driver a good workplace

Novelty / Innovation

The very well-executed work of engineering with precise design is a novelty on the market, but not yet a fundamental innovation. The familiar principle of the mast structure has been improved using the most up-to-date engineering methods and newly available materials.

Customer benefit

The reduced mast oscillations undoubtedly enhance comfort for the driver, both by avoiding the risk or uncertainty caused by swaying and by reducing the need to actively prevent or reduce swaying. The economic advantage results from the faster execution of storage and retrieval operations, which is achieved by reducing the swaying movements of the mast when the mast is pushed, when the truck is traveling with the mast extended and when the forks are lifted and lowered.

Market relevance

Reach trucks are an important category of industrial trucks for operating racking in narrow aisles, alongside track-guided narrow-aisle trucks. They are used for storage above around 8 m and extend up to roughly 14 m. Of course, they are also used for storage and retrieval below 8 m and for picking up pallets from the floor. Overall, reach trucks are versatile machines that can be used for a wide range of warehouse tasks. The relevance of this development for the market segment is significant.

IFOY verdict

The ESR 1200 avoids mast vibrations thanks to its precise design and therefore offers high functional benefits for users without active vibration damping. The resulting reduction in process times and the increased comfort for users justify a high level of customer benefit for a wide range of applications.
